Veteran benefits

Mesothelioma patients can get VA benefits that can help pay for their medical treatment. Veterans with mesothelioma may be eligible for disability compensation or a pension in accordance with their severity. They should work with an attorney certified by the VA to ensure that they fill out the proper forms and meet all essential requirements.

VA health insurance can include treatments by some of best mesothelioma specialists in the country. The VA has two world-renowned mesothelioma surgeons who are Dr. Daniel Wiener, in Boston, and Dr. Robert Cameron, in Los Angeles. The VA will cover travel costs when an individual from the local VA refers a patient suffering from mesothelioma or other cancer to one of these surgeons.

The VA offers home healthcare benefits that help pay for the cost of hiring a person to help a mesothelioma law firms patient with their daily tasks. These benefits are referred to as Aid and Attendance. A veteran must meet certain criteria to qualify for these benefits, including needing someone else to assist them bathe and dress, as well as eat. A mesothelioma lawyer can discuss these requirements in detail and assist veterans in completing the necessary paperwork to receive the benefits.

A mesothelioma expert can help a veteran file a claim with VA for asbestosis caused by service or mesothelioma. The process can take a few months, but VA certified lawyers have helped many veterans get their claims approved quickly.

Children and spouses of veterans who have died from mesothelioma or an asbestos-related disease, could be eligible for education benefits. These benefits can be used to pay for education at a college, career training or apprenticeships. These benefits are provided through the Survivors and Dependents Educational Assistance Program (DEA or Chapter 35).
